From the FastLoaders' Blu-Ray "Live from the Underworld", a concert of music from the game "The
Last Ninja" performed at the Underworld Club in Camden on October 15th, 2016.
Get the full video download or the amazing Blu-Ray at c64audio.com/ninja
Performed by FastLoaders and Ben Daglish. Composed by Ben Daglish, Copyright High Technology Publishing Ltd. "The Last Ninja" is a registered trademark of System 3 Software Limited.
